National News for School Assembly 19 November 2022

Here is some of the latest national news for the school assembly on 19 November 2022:
  • The government has reintroduced the drafted Data Protection Bill for public dialogue after 3 months of suspension.
  • A driver for the Ministry of External Affairs was apprehended by the Delhi Police's Crime Branch unit on accusations of espionage for allegedly disclosing private information to a man from Pakistan.
  • The National Human Rights Commission (NHRC) to include Bhaswati Mukherjee (former ambassador), Suhas Chakma (director of Rights and Risk Analysis Group, RRAG), and Jitender Singh Shunty, a Padma Shree awardee (former BJP MLA) to join the reconstituted 13- member core group of human rights defenders and NGOs.
  • The Supreme Court of India refuses to address a case against "Population Explosion".
  • The Minister of Home Affairs, Amit Shah delivers a statement stating that Terrorism should not be linked with religions, and both are entirely separate subjects.
  • The current Jammu and Kashmir Chief Minister Farooq Abdullah stepped down from the position of National Conference President to allow the young generation to take up the responsibility.
  • PM Modi indirectly stated the "China-Pakistan" relations saying that such relatings are the finance of terror in the name of state support.
  • At an ongoing event, "U.N. climate summit" in Egypt, the Indian Union Environment Minister Bhupender Yadav, says, there will not be any climate crisis if the CO2 emission of countries would be pf the same level as India.
  • Congress President Mallikarjun Kharge abolished all committees set up in Uttar Pradesh in preparation for the Assembly elections.

International News for School Assembly 19 November 2022

Students may collect the top international happenings for school assemble news for 19 November 2022:
  • North Korean missile, according to the Japanese PM Kishida, crashed in "exclusive economic waters".
  • Democrat Nancy Pelosi, speaker of the U.S. House of Representatives, to step down as party leader in January when Republicans take control of the chamber.
  •  Chinese President Xi Jinping stated that after the event of lockdown from the start of the COVID-19 pandemic, as the first international event, China would consider hosting the 3rd "Belt & Road Forum" for International Cooperation next year.
  • Arif Alvi, the president of Pakistan, charged India with adopting a "no peace" strategy by refusing to work with his nation.

Sports News for School Assembly 19 November 2022

Collect the latest sports events for the school assembly on 19th November 2022:
  • Even without the toss, the first T20 International between India and New Zealand was called off due to severe rain.
  • FIFA World Cup 2022 to begin on November 20, 2022, in Qatar and will be participated by 32 teams.
  • Argentina forward Lionel Messi to retire after the FIFA World Cup 2022 as his final world cup.
  • Sebastian Vettel retires after the final Grand Prix, where seven-time world champion Lewis Hamilton says that even though it will be his last race, he hopes for a comeback with Formula One.
